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00118 | $0.00965 |
| Opus 5 | $0.00059 | $0.00483 |
| Sonnet 5 | $0.00024 | $0.00193 |
| Haiku 4.5 | $0.00012 | $0.00097 |

How it starts
The opening of the file, as written. The whole thing — 90 lines — stays where its author put it; the contents beside it link to each section on GitHub.
/deploy-team — configurable agent teams via Codex CLI
Spawns N codex CLI processes in parallel, each with a distinct role prompt,
shared access to a thread, and (optionally) shared context files. Returns a
concatenated report the main agent reads and synthesizes.
When to use a team vs a single subagent
- Single subagent (via native Agent tool): focused, single-responsibility work with a known output shape. Example: "research agent: find 3 recent papers on X and summarize."
- Team (
/deploy-team): multi-perspective work where agents should see each other's findings and challenge them. Example: "gauntlet a new experiment idea — brainstorm, research, attack, validate."
Invocation
python3 .agents/skills/deploy-team/runtime/orchestrator.py \
--template gauntlet \
--topic "should we run the quadratic readout PC control next?" \
[--context matrix-thinking/KILL_LIST.md EXPERIMENT_LOG.md] \
[--max-minutes 15]
Or with a custom config instead of a template:
python3 .agents/skills/deploy-team/runtime/orchestrator.py \
--config path/to/custom-team.json \
--topic "..."
Templates
- gauntlet — 4 agents: brainstormer, researcher, attacker, validator. For: new ideas. The attacker tries to kill; validator checks survivors.
- pre-launch-audit — 3 agents: security, correctness, simplicity. For: reviewing experiment scripts / new code before GPU time.
- post-run-analysis — 3 agents: positive, adversarial, contextualizer. For: interpreting a completed run from multiple angles.
- blog-coherence — 2 agents: style, factual-alignment. For: verifying a new finding doesn't contradict existing site content.
Custom templates live in .agents/skills/deploy-team/templates/*.json.
Run artifacts
Each run creates .team-runs/<run-id>/:
config.json— resolved config (template + topic + context)thread.md— shared append-only thread (agents post findings for peers)context/— symlinked context files agents can readagents/<name>/prompt.txt— the exact prompt sentoutput.md— agent's final written findingsevents.jsonl— raw stream-json events (debug)
REPORT.md— combined report generated by the orchestrator
